APODACA, Elia; HERNANDEZ-PEREZ, Carlos R. y RODRIGUEZ-GONZALEZ, María Guadalupe. Management of patients with Myelodysplastic Syndrome in the COVID-19 era. Gac. Méd. Méx [online]. 2021, vol.157, suppl.3, pp.S47-S51. Epub 25-Abr-2022. ISSN 2696-1288. https://doi.org/10.24875/gmm.m21000470.
SARS-CoV-2 infection has caused a change in the way we care for patients with hematological diseases around the world. Patients with myelodysplastic syndrome (MDS) have been affected by the lack of knowledge of the behavior of COVID-19 in this type of condition. International guidelines have been established that have made it possible to continue caring for these patients. The main objective of this review is to define the preventive measures and treatment strategies that should be taken when evaluating a patient with myelodysplastic syndrome in the COVID-19 era.
